pandaK posted:

Does speed apply a score multiplier or something? What's the benefit of boosting it up?

It just speeds/slows down how the notes fall, allowing for them to show up closer/further apart. It makes it easier for some people to play.

Zettace
Nov 30, 2009

pandaK posted:

Does speed apply a score multiplier or something? What's the benefit of boosting it up?
No matter the speed, the rhythm the notes have to hit at doesn't change. The speed is basically the speed it takes for a note to travel from the top of the screen to the bottom.

High speeds are more preferable for most people because it means less notes on screen at one time. This leads to less confusion and lets your reflexes and muscle memory do the work.

At slower speeds the notes linger on screen for a while and build up leading to scenes like this:
